White dwarfs are stars that have burned up all of the hydrogen they once used as nuclear fuel. Fusion in a star's core produces heat and outward pressure, but this pressure is kept in balance by the inward push of gravity generated by a star's mass.

A white dwarf is a very small dense star that is the size of a typical planet. It is formed when the star has exhausted all of its fuel and layers.
